Right to Pride:
Building off of Uber’s existing Right to Move platform, we created Right to Pride as a multichannel LGBTQ+ campaign. For a company that millions of people have multiple touchpoints with every day, our goal was to push for bold, accountable support, tangible actions/commitments, and use of the platform to educate and advance inclusion. The end result was a cohesive campaign across social, digital, and in-app banners which conveyed Uber’s belief that everyone should have the right to move and live freely and safely, exactly as they are. The campaign was the most well-received Pride campaign at Uber, with over 20 countries launching it using our toolkit.
National Coming Out Day:
After Pride Month, we were again engaged to create a campaign for National Coming Out Day. Keenly aware that coming out is both a privilege and a burden, our approach stemmed from the reality that coming out moments (and the accompanying safety and acceptance considerations) happen all day, every day — even when one steps into an Uber. We partnered with Gottmik, as well as three other influential members of the LGBTQIA+ community, to share their stories and let the world in on what coming out and allyship means to them. Collectively, the two campaigns garnered tens of millions of impressions.
